      We are redesigning this site http://www.crystalshop.co.uk/ but not reinstating the ecommerce yet so the primary aim of the site is to increase foot traffic in the shops. The list of shops on the RHS of the homepage is really messy  but is useful. I would like to move these to the footer... is this a bad idea?

      If this is, is it a bit of a gamble to move it to the bottom of the homepage rather than higher up as it is? We are already featuring a link to the shop finder page but I want to get the locations in as prominent place as possible but it's quite a long list!

        I think the best practice would be to create a dropdown near the top of the page, enclosed in a

        <nav>html5 tag.

        http://html5doctor.com/nav-element/

        According to at least one other site:

        <nav></nav>

        This new element can give search engine indexing algorithms clues to the information architecture of your website, (just like how sitemaps help them gain a better understanding of the website’s structure).

        This is what you want, right?  To create a better looking structure but not necessarily make it a long list in a prominent spot?
